Students, faculty, and staff researchers (and faculty advisors) who file IRB applications must complete online training offered by the Collaborative Institutional Training Initiative (CITI). All researchers (including faculty advisors) engaged in a research project using human subjects are required to complete a course in Human Subjects Research and be listed on the research protocol.

The Human Subjects Research course provides basic training in the conduct of ethical human subjects research. This course is targeted to the type of research generally conducted at ¾ÅÐãÖ±²¥: social and behavioral research studies such as those often conducted in the areas of psychology, communications, education, sociology, counseling, and business.Ìý

CITI training must be completed by all researchers and advisors listed on the IRB applicationÌýbefore the application can be considered complete for submission.Ìý

The available CITI courses are listed below. TheÌýHuman Subjects ResearchÌýcourses are those required by the IRB.

6 Categories of Courses are available including:

1. Human Subjects Research

  • "IRB Researchers and Sponsors - Basic Course" -Ìýrequired by non-student researchers and sponsors.
  • "IRB Student ResearchersÌý - Basic Course" - required by undergraduate and graduate student researchers.
  • "IRB Members" - required by members who sit on the JCU IRB.

2. Animal Care and Use

  • These courses are optional and designed for those who conduct research with live animals at JCU or sit on the JCU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ee (IACUC).

3. Conflicts of Interest

  • Required for PHS-funded researchers

4. Health Information Privacy & Security (HIPS)

  • IPS covers data protection principles, focusing on the healthcare-related privacy and information security requirements of the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) and the educational records and data-related requirements of the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A).

5. Responsible Conduct of Research: RCR Course for Grant Workers

  • Required for federally funded researchers and their workers.

6. Good Clinical Practice (GCP) Certification:ÌýOften required for researchers receiving federal funding

  • GCP – Social and Behavioral Research Best Practices for Clinical Research
  • GCP for Clinical Trials with Investigational Drugs and Medical Devices (U.S. FDA Focus)
  • GCP for Clinical Trials with Investigational Drugs and Biologics (ICH Focus)
  • GCP for Clinical Investigations of Devices
